Solomons is in Calvert County, in the Washington-Arlington metro area.
The community was named for Isaac Solomon, landowner who built a cannery here.
The latitude of Solomons is 38.318N. The longitude is -76.454W.
It is in the Eastern Standard time zone. Elevation is 0 feet.The population, at the time of the 2000 census, was 1,536.
The island became less isolated with construction of the Gov. Thomas Johnson Bridge in 1977.
